About QRZ XML
QRZ XML is an application designed for you to use your existing QRZ.com XML Data subscription for performing callsign lookups. This application is not affiliated with QRZ.com, however a QRZ.com XML Data subscription is required in order to use the app. This is because the app uses QRZ.com's XML Data API in the same way various QSO logging programs do.
